    For those who don't know what LIO is: it's a modular audio platform built around an ultra-quiet UltraCapacitor-based power supply, which can be configured to be any combination of:
    • An RVC (resistor volume control) or AVC (autoformer volume control, like the icOn preamps) preamp with optional tube stage
      There also exist a DHT module for it, but it's a different machine altogether
    • A DAC
    • A phono preamp
    • An headphone amp
    • A power amp
    The preamp is really the heart of the LIO, since all the other components are connected to it. The AVC+tube is the most transparent preamp I've personally heard and also incredibly quiet (I also have the VR120 power amp, which has a very high gain and, as a result, reveals noise upstream very easily: Freya S has a faint but noticeable hiss with Susvara, LIO is dead silent. So is Kara). While the other components might seem 'cheap' on their own (e.g. the headphone amp module), they all benefit from the UltraCap power supply and the preamp and perform well above their individual price tag.

    Anyhoo, the one I'm selling is a fantastic preamp and doubles up as a very good headphone and 25W/8R speaker amp.
    Note: the tubes can be defeated - for pure AVC - if desired.
